Dezhurov and Strekalov review EVA procedures

NM18-304-016 (March-July 1995) --- Cosmonauts Vladimir N. Dezhurov (left) and Gennadiy M. Strekalov study a small model of the Mir Space Station prior to one of their five space walks. At a July 18 press coonference in Houston, the two told reporters that the model was helpful in locating strategic points on the various modules, for example, hand rails and foot restraints. Along with astronaut Norman E. Thagard, the two went onto spend 115 days on Mir.
